History of Polar Pumps

The company was formed in 1965 to carry out commercial and industrial refrigeration and air-conditioning installations and maintenance. The experience acquired in that length of time has enabled Polar Pumps Ltd. to understand the needs of the industry and in 1988 to take the step of also designing, manufacturing and marketing a comprehensive range of refrigerant handling equipment to handle all refrigerants at this time we also opened our training establishment which is a Construction Skills (Formerly CITB) and City & Guilds approved training and assessment centre offering a wide range of courses for the Refrigeration, Air Conditioning and Electrical Industries.
Polar Pumps Ltd. is on the Official Defence Contractors List with its products NATO codified. As a member of the British Refrigeration Association and Institute of refrigeration they are committed to offering the best service to the industry.

Polar Pumps Manufacturing facility and training centre is conveniently located south of Doncaster close to A1M, M1, M18, M62 motorways and the main railway lines. It covers an area of 7000 sq.ft housing design, manufacturing, assembly, stores, testing, offices, lecture rooms and 'hands-on' tuition workshops.
